Thomas Say (Anglice: Thomas Say Philadelphiae die 27 Iunii 1787 natus; ibidem mortuus die 10 Octobris 1834) fuit zoologiae, entomologiae, malacologiae, carcinologiae et Taxonomiae peritus Americanus.

Opera[recensere]
- 1824-1828, American Entomology, or Descriptions of the Insects of North America, 3 volumes, Philadelphia.
- 1836, American Conchology, or Descriptions of the Shells of North America Illustrated From Coloured Figures From Original Drawings Executed from Nature, Parts 1 - 6, New Harmony, 1830-1834; Part 7, Philadelphia.
